    Hello, why are we assigning the ether2-LAN interface an ip address please? Thank you.

    • @IgoroTech-Official
      @IgoroTech-Official  Рік тому +3

      hi there, yes, we need to set IP address for the LAN so all the devices connected to ether2 will be on the same subnet or will automatically receive IP address if you enabled the DHCP server. If you don't assign IP address to the ether2 or LAN interface then all the LAN devices cannot receive IP address or it short, it will not work.

    good day sir..why i cant acces internet on my laptop using mikrotik..i cant even ping.google ..it says "unidentified network..pls.help thanks👃

    • @IgoroTech-Official
      @IgoroTech-Official  11 місяців тому +1

      hi there, "Unidentified network" means your laptop is not receiving IP address or misconfiguration on the IP address. If you set the MikroTik as DCHP server then make sure to set your laptop to obtain an IP address automatically (DHCP). If you did not set DHCP server on the MikroTik then manually configure your laptop IP address within the same subnet with the MikroTik LAN.
